What is Lido?

You already use spreadsheets to keep track of everything. Now, you can automate tasks and create custom workflows directly from your spreadsheet data with formulas, not code.

  • Send emails automatically with custom spreadsheet triggers including dates, cell values, and new rows.
  • Send Slack updates on a schedule or when conditions are met.
  • Extract data from PDFs into spreadsheets.
  • Autofill Google Docs templates from sheets and forms.

Build automations directly from your spreadsheet

Trigger actions with new formulas like =SENDGMAIL() and =CREATEPDF(). Combine them with existing Google Sheets formulas to build custom automation logic for any repetitive task.

  • Order confirmations: When a new form is submitted, calculate a total then send a confirmation email to the purchaser and copy your team.
  • Deadlines and due dates: Send an email 7 days before or after a date in your spreadsheet.
  • KPI reporting: Send the latest metrics out every day to your team via Slack and Email.
  • Status updates and approvals: Send an email and Slack message when a value changes from “Not Approved” to “Approved”·
